JARRYD Roughead has been withdrawn from Hawthorn's clash against Port Adelaide tomorrow.

Hawks coach Alastair Clarkson this morning confirmed the star big man would miss the trip to Launceston because of an ankle issue.

Roughead has shouldered a heavy load this season, playing all but one game in his comeback from a serious achilles injury.

His withdrawal affects 42,268 SuperCoaches (11.2 per cent of all players).

Roughead is averaging 104 points per game since taking up a ruck-forward role for the Hawks this season in the absence of Max Bailey.

It means the Hawks will be without two of its prized talls, Roughead and spearhead Lance Franklin, who will miss his fifth consecutive match with a hamstring injury.

Both are expected to play against Gold Coast at the MCG tomorrow week.
